Cloning and analysis of the gene from Xanthomonas citri involved in plant growth

摘要

Periplasmic glucans has been suspected to be responsible for the pathogen to attach to the host plant cell especially in the cause of the infection by Agrobacterium tumefaciens and Pseudomonas syringae. The pathogen of citrus canker, Xanthomonas citri, produces a very unique periplasmic glucan. We have isolated the transposon Tn3-Spice mutant inserted into the region homologous to chvA of A. tumefaciens from X.citri, and this mutant was shown to be deficient in multiplication of the pathogen in the host plant. Here, we report the cloning and analysis of the ORF where Tn3-Spice was inserted, as it should be involved in in planta growth of the pathogen. From homology search, this gene was suggested to encode for the secretory function during the first stage of its infection.
